To print a software configuration label
1. Turn the On/Off switch to the off position.
2. Press and hold the Feed/Pause button while turning the printer on. The
printer prints out a hardware configuration label.
3. Set the DIP switches to print out the software test label.
Top Bank Set switches 1 through 6 and 8 off. Set switch 7 on.
Bottom Bank Set switches 1 through 8 off.
4. Hold the Feed/Pause button down for 1 second. The printer prints out the
software configuration label.
5. Turn the printer power off and then on.
6. Return the DIP switches to their original settings.
Setting the MSN for Intermec Media and Ribbon
For direct thermal media, use the three-digit sensitivity number located on the
roll of media to set the sensitivity number. You can also use the values from the
tables in the next section.
For thermal transfer media, you need to look in two places to determine the
sensitivity number. The sensitivity number on each roll of thermal transfer
media or ribbon has an asterisk (*) in place of one of the digits. On thermal
transfer media, the rating contains the first and second digits, with an asterisk
in place of the third digit. The number on the ribbon has the first and third
digits, with an asterisk in place of the second digit.
To optimize the sensitivity number for thermal transfer media, you combine the
digits as in this example.
Media or Ribbon
Sensitivity
Number Description
Thermal transfer media 56* The asterisk reserves the third digit to
identify the ribbon’s sensitivity number.
Thermal transfer ribbon 5*7 The asterisk reserves the second digit to
identify the media’s sensitivity number.
567 Optimized sensitivity number
